What is Lost Wax Casting?
 
carvingThere is fabrication, and then there is Lost Wax. These are the two original ancient techniques for making jewelry. Unlike fabrication where you work directly with the metal, Lost Wax Casting is the creation of a wax model by carving and heating. This model is then attached to a wax rod or "sprue" and placed on a rubber base. A flask is attached to this that will create a well. A plaster-like substance called "investment" is poured into this flask and set to harden. This is then fired in a kiln burning out the wax(hence the name "Lost Wax") and leaving a hardened mold. Molten metal is then poured into the mold to create the final piece.
